拉致
意味
Abduction; kidnapping; the forcible seizure and removal of a person against their will.
In Japan, 拉致 carries especially strong connotations due to the abduction of Japanese citizens by North Korean agents, primarily in the 1970s and 1980s. The issue became a defining national concern after North Korea acknowledged in 2002 that it had abducted Japanese nationals. 拉致被害者 (abduction victims) and 拉致問題 (the abduction issue) are standard fixed phrases in this context. The word is also used in general criminal or political contexts.

起源と歴史
From Chinese 拉致 — 拉 (ra) meaning 'to pull, to drag' and 致 (chi) meaning 'to bring, to cause'. The compound denotes dragging someone to a place against their will, entering widespread Japanese use particularly in diplomatic and criminal contexts.
